Today, I finally throw in the towel and decide definitely to go with the World Teach program in China. There are a number of reasons but certainly one of the most compelling is the connection with Pearl Buck.

Aside: Pearl Buck (author of The Good Earth and winner of Pulitzer Prize and Nobel Peace Prize) is a relative. Her mother and my great-grandfather were siblings, and she was born in The Stulting family house in West Viginia - when her missionary parents were on leave from China - where my father was later born and which is now a historic house museum! PB also wrote The Exile, which is obviously less well-known but which is the history of the Stulting family, beginning in The Netherlands through their immigration to the US.

Now I'm going to have to go back and find out exactly where they were posted in China.
